Product Description:

Original score composed by Tan Dun.

Music performed by The Shanghai Symphony Orchestra, Shanghai National Orchestra, Shanghai Percussion Ensemble.

Engineers: Richard King, Lu Xiao Xing, Xu Gou Qin.

CROUCHING TIGER, HIDDEN DRAGON won the 2002 Grammy Award for Best Score Soundtrack Album For A Motion Picture, Television Or Other Visual Media.

This is not your typical martial arts film soundtrack, but then again, Ang Lee's epic CROUCHING TIGER, HIDDEN DRAGON is not your typical martial arts film. Though it features the flying footwork of Michelle Yeo and Chow Yun Fat, the movie brings martial arts movie-making to a new level with its artistic cinematography and classic story line.

Modern classical composer Tan Dun, renowned for his forward-looking compositons, has crafted a soundtrack that incorporates traditional Asian motifs, atmospheric orchestral touches, and some decidedly modernist strokes. Dun is aided in his endeavor by cello virtuoso Yo-Yo Ma, who contributes poignant solos throughout the recording.
